**Ticket PROC-ROT: expired creds on proctor queue**

Hey on-call — the Examgate proctoring queue stopped pulling sessions around 02:10. Turns out the svc-proctorq credential expired and nobody got the Keywheel reminder (classic). Consumers are just idling, so no data loss, but candidates are stacking up. Swap in the fresh credential, bounce the workers, and confirm queue depth drains. The new key is pasted below.

service key, fawip-bajef: kto11_Qt5wZK9vdNC

Ticket #917 — Tidewatch widget connection failures

Tidewatch tide-table widget intermittently fails to load predictions. Errors point to DB timeouts, not the upstream feed. Check pooler config on the Gullport node; restarting clears it temporarily. Assigning to you since Priya is out. Reproduce against staging first. Staging tide DB uses the connection string below.

primary connection of yagep-kahip = redis://giliel_svc:zYiKsLL2PLpfPL@db-348f.xolmarsys.corp:5432/fenwyn

Hey folks — handing off LiftPath release duties to Mara while I'm out. The elevator-dispatch simulator ships Thursdays; build 4.2 is staged and the scenario packs are frozen. Only gotcha: the dispatch-core artifact won't promote unless it's signed before the smoke suite kicks off, so do that first, not after. Everything else is in the runbook on the Ostermill wiki. Mara, you'll need the deploy key to push to the release channel, so pasting it here for the sync notes.

deploy key for tawip-bawig: bky13_1zSxDtVxnNkjh

Ticket: Staging env misconfigured for Siftgate bloom filter

The bloom layer in front of the Pellet KV store is rejecting all lookups in staging because the env file was copied from the dev template without credentials. False-positive tuning values are fine; only the auth line is missing. To unblock the weekly demo, the Pellet admission secret must be set on the following line.

env line for yaguf-fajop: LEDGER_TOKEN13=fb08984397349